Cod in Tomato-Curry Sauce

The Strategy:

This recipe transforms incredibly delicate, flaky cod fillets by poaching them directly in a fiercely aromatic, golden-hued broth of blooming turmeric, curry powder, and bursting cherry tomatoes. Introducing thick, luxurious coconut cream at the very end mellows the sharp heat of the Fresno chili and fresh ginger, creating a velvety, deeply complex tomato-curry sauce that completely envelops the mild white fish. Serving the cod in wide, shallow bowls ensures every inch of the tender fillet remains submerged in the rich, fragrant broth, establishing a deeply comforting, hyper-flavorful coastal main.

Neighborly Grace

  • THE PRESENTATION: Carefully transfer the delicate, opaque cod fillets into wide, shallow ceramic bowls, then aggressively ladle the golden, bursting tomato and coconut cream broth over the top until the fish is nearly submerged. Garnish heavily with fresh chopped dill to cut through the rich coconut curry.
  • THE POUR: The intense aromatics of the curry and the rich, cooling coconut cream require a wine with substantial aromatics and sharp acidity. A vibrantly chilled, highly aromatic New Zealand Sauvignon Blanc or an icy, fruit-forward Viognier flawlessly manages the spice and cuts through the velvety sauce.
  • THE VIBE: Warm, intensely aromatic indoor evenings. This is the meal you execute on a breezy evening when you want to fill the house with incredible spice profiles, served with massive stacks of warm naan bread to soak up every drop of the golden curry.
